To fill out an advance care directive, follow these steps:
02
Gather the necessary forms: Start by obtaining the advance care directive forms specific to your state or country. These can usually be found online or at your local health department.
03
Understand the purpose: Familiarize yourself with the purpose and importance of an advance care directive. It is a legal document that outlines your preferences for medical treatment if you become unable to make decisions for yourself.
04
Choose a healthcare proxy: Select a trustworthy person to be your healthcare proxy or agent. This individual will make healthcare decisions on your behalf if you are unable to do so.
05
Outline your wishes: Reflect on and document your treatment preferences. Consider different scenarios and what medical interventions you would want or not want in each situation. Be specific and clear in your instructions.
06
Discuss with loved ones: Share your wishes with your loved ones and have a conversation about your decision. It is crucial for them to understand your choices and to have their support.
07
Complete the form: Fill out the advance care directive form accurately and thoroughly. Ensure that all required sections are properly filled and signed. If necessary, consult an attorney or medical professional for guidance.
08
Distribute copies: Make copies of your completed advance care directive and distribute them to your healthcare proxy, healthcare providers, and family members. Keep a copy for your records as well.
09
Review and update as needed: Regularly review your advance care directive to ensure that it still reflects your current wishes. Make updates whenever there are changes in your health status or personal preferences.
10
Remember that laws and forms may vary, so it is important to familiarize yourself with the specific requirements of your jurisdiction.

Who needs make an advance care?

01
Anyone who wants to have a say in their medical treatment in case they are unable to communicate or make decisions for themselves needs to make an advance care directive.
02
Specifically, individuals with serious illnesses, seniors, or those facing end-of-life decisions should consider creating an advance care directive. It provides a way to ensure that your medical wishes are respected and followed by healthcare providers and loved ones.
03
It is also important for individuals who do not have close family members or a healthcare proxy designated to make decisions on their behalf. In such cases, an advance care directive can help ensure that their preferences are known and honored.
04
Ultimately, making an advance care directive is a personal choice, but it is recommended for anyone who wants to have control over their medical treatment and receive care that aligns with their values and preferences.

Make an advance care is a legal document that allows an individual to specify their preferences for medical treatment in the event that they are unable to communicate their wishes.
Anyone over the age of 18 and of sound mind can file an advance care document.
To fill out an advance care document, the individual must specify their preferences for medical treatment, appoint a healthcare proxy, and sign the document in the presence of a witness.
The purpose of an advance care document is to ensure that an individual's wishes regarding medical treatment are honored if they become unable to communicate those wishes.
Information reported on an advance care document may include specific medical treatments the individual does or does not want, organ donation preferences, and appointing a healthcare proxy.
